What we are looking for :

  • Education

Post-secondary degree or diploma in a relevant area of study (e.g. Indigenous studies and / or communications and / or environmental sciences or related field).

  • Experience
  • Three to five years of experience working in Indigenous relations and / or communications or engagement.

  • Experience working in Indigenous communities is an asset.
  • Experience communicating in group forums with Indigenous Nations and organizations at the member / citizen and staff level is an asset.
  • Experience working on a multidisciplinary team is an asset.
  • Preference may be given to applicants who self-identify as having Indigenous heritage (First Nations, Métis or Inuit).
  • Knowledge, Skills & Abilities
  • Highly organized with the ability to work under pressure and meet tight deadlines.

  • Ability to connect and promote collaborative engagement with Indigenous Nations, communities, and organization representatives in a culturally appropriate way.
  • Understanding of traditional use studies and their meaningful consideration and integration in projects and operations.
  • Superior written and oral skills, including composition, grammar, terminology, writing style and approach in preparing effective, well-written, high-quality informative content and reports for a variety of technical and public audiences.
  • Strong interpersonal, oral, and written communication and presentation skills, including the ability to demonstrate tact and diplomacy when addressing issues, conflicts, or negotiations.
  • Ability to communicate complex technical / scientific / environmental information to public audiences in clear, understandable language.
  • Ability to develop meaningful, community-relevant communications materials for Indigenous Peoples and the public.
  • Strong priority management and project management skills, with superior ability to work with cross-functional teams and manage multiple projects with diverse requirements and deadlines.
  • Knowledge of MS Office suite.
  • Valid driver’s licence.
  • Knowledge of issues affecting Indigenous Peoples, engagement best practices, and Canada’s history with Indigenous Peoples
  • Security Clearance Eligibility Required
  • Reliability Status with Site Access Security Clearance (SASC), which has a minimum requirement of 3-5 years of verifiable history in Canada, Australia, New Zealand, the United States and / or the United Kingdom. CNL implements security screening in accordance with the Treasury Board of Canada Secretariat's “Standard on Security Screening” and the “Policy on Government Security.”

    Working conditions

  • Working schedule : Five (5) days per week, seven and a half (7.5) hours per day for a thirty-seven and a half (37.5) hour work week.
  • Works sitting / standing in front of a computer screen for most / all of the workday.
  • Some travel will be required.
  • Project and community site visits are required, which include walking the land and natural spaces with varying typography including rough terrain, hills, during all seasons and weather.
